Anyway I have a Kantronics unit  KAM XL and was wondering if anyone had figured 
out if it was possible to use the KAM with the 5000A.

Yes.  You have to construct a cable.  Use the RCA line-in and line-out for the 
audio and use the RCA PTT for keying.

It would be really nice if AWGPE Pro supported separate audio for line-in and 
line-out rather than assuming both are on the same sound card (A pre Windows XP 
programming thing) so it could be used with VAC and then a hardware TNC would 
not be a requirement.  I have contacted the developer about it but one voice 
does not get one's attention.
